Monthly climate in Usehat, India

Last updated: July 31, 2025

Under the Köppen–Geiger climate classification Usehat features a humid subtropical climate (Cwa). Temperatures typically range between 14 °C (57 °F) and 32 °C (90 °F) through the year, but rarely can drop to 4 °C (39 °F) or can rise to as high as 43 °C (110 °F). The average annual precipitation amounts to about 868 mm (34.2 inches) and receives 93 rainy days on the 1 mm (0.04 inches) threshold annually. Usehat enjoys an average of 3659 hours of sunshine throughout the year, and daylight varies from 10 hours 24 minutes to 13 hours 51 minutes per day.

Monthly average temperatures in Usehat, India

The warmest months in Usehat are May, June and July, with daily mean temperatures ranging from 31 to 32 °C (87 - 90 °F) throughout the day. The coldest temperatures usually occur in January, February and December, when daily mean temperatures range from 14 to 17 °C (57 - 63 °F) throughout the day. On average each year, Usehat experiences 255 days above 25 °C (77.0 °F) and 0 days below 0 °C (32.0 °F).

Monthly average precipitation in Usehat, India

Usehat usually has the most precipitation in July, August and September, with an average of 22 rainy days and 225 mm (8.9 inches) of precipitation per month. The driest months in Usehat are April, November and December. On average, 9 mm (0.4 inches) of precipitation falls during these months.

Monthly sunshine hours in Usehat, India

The sunniest months in Usehat are April, May and June, when the sun shines an average of 11 hours 37 minutes a day. Least sunny months in Usehat: January, February and December receive an average of 8 hours 42 minutes of sunshine daily.

Solar UV radiation in Usehat, India

Usehat experiences the highest level of ultraviolet (UV) radiation in June, July and August, when the maximum UV index can reach values of 11 - 12, which corresponds to the Extreme category of sun exposure. January, February and December are in the Moderate / High exposure category. In these months, the maximum values of the UV index do not exceed 6.
